Why Do Business People Prefer Luxury Corporate Apartments? 3 min read Business Why Do Business People Prefer Luxury Corporate Apartments? Steffy Alen 2 years ago People working in the corporate sector often travel to different locations and stay there for a while. These businessmen often sacrifice their comfort & privacy... Read More